买了云服务器怎么建站,购买云服务器后如何快速搭建自己的网站?
- 综合资讯
- 2025-03-13 17:47:45
- 4

购买了云服务器后,您可以通过以下步骤快速搭建自己的网站:,1. **选择操作系统**:在云服务器的控制面板中选择合适的操作系统(如Linux或Windows)。,2....
购买了云服务器后,您可以通过以下步骤快速搭建自己的网站:,1. **选择操作系统**:在云服务器的控制面板中选择合适的操作系统(如Linux或Windows)。,2. **安装Web服务器软件**:例如Apache、Nginx等,用于处理HTTP请求。,3. **配置域名解析**:将您的域名指向云服务器的IP地址。,4. **创建网站目录和文件**:在Web服务器上创建网站的根目录,并放置HTML、CSS、JavaScript等相关文件。,5. **设置数据库**:如果需要使用数据库(如MySQL),则需安装并配置数据库服务。,6. **编写或导入网站内容**:准备网站的内容,包括文本、图片、视频等资源。,7. **测试网站功能**:确保所有页面都能正常加载,链接正确,功能齐全。,8. **安全与优化**:实施必要的网络安全措施,并对网站进行性能优化以提高访问速度。,通过以上步骤,您可以快速且高效地利用云服务器来建立和维护自己的网站。
准备工作
在开始之前,我们需要明确一点:建立一个网站不仅仅是简单地购买一台云服务器那么简单,它涉及到多个环节和步骤,包括但不限于域名注册、服务器配置、网站设计开发以及后续维护等,在进行任何操作之前,我们都应该做好充分的准备。
选择合适的云服务提供商
在选择云服务提供商时,需要考虑以下几个因素:
- 可靠性:确保所选的服务商能够提供稳定的服务,避免因网络故障或硬件问题导致网站无法正常运行的情况发生。
- 性能:高性能的服务器可以为用户提供更好的用户体验,例如更快的页面加载速度和更高的并发处理能力。
- 安全性:数据安全和隐私保护是构建网站的另一个重要方面,选择具有 robust 安全措施的服务商可以降低遭受攻击的风险。
- 价格:预算也是决定因素之一,不同服务商的价格和服务范围各不相同,需要根据自己的需求和经济状况进行权衡。
注册域名
域名的选择对于网站的知名度和访问量有着直接的影响,应该尽量选择易于记忆且与业务相关的域名,还需要注意以下几点:
- 合法性:确保选择的域名不侵犯他人的合法权益,否则可能会面临法律纠纷。
- 可用性:检查所选域名的所有者信息,确认该域名是否已经被他人注册。
- 备案要求:在中国境内运营的网站需要进行ICP备案,因此在选择域名时也要考虑到这一点。
配置服务器环境
购买云服务器后,需要对服务器进行必要的配置工作,以使其满足网站运行的需求,这通常包括操作系统安装、防火墙设置、数据库管理等任务。
- 操作系统选择:常见的有Windows Server和Linux(如Ubuntu、CentOS等),不同的操作系统适用于不同的场景和应用场景,可以根据实际需求进行选择。
- 安全策略:开启必要的网络安全功能,如防病毒软件、入侵检测系统等,以防止恶意攻击和数据泄露。
- 资源管理:合理分配CPU、内存和网络带宽等资源,以确保网站的流畅运行。
安装Web服务器软件
Web服务器软件负责接收客户端请求并将其转发给相应的应用程序进行处理,常用的Web服务器软件有Apache、Nginx等,以下是安装这些软件的基本流程:
图片来源于网络,如有侵权联系删除
- 下载源码包:从官方网站下载最新版本的源码包。
- 编译安装:按照官方文档提供的指导步骤进行编译和安装。
- 配置文件:修改默认配置文件以满足特定需求,如端口绑定、虚拟主机管理等。
设计网站界面
在设计网站界面时,需要考虑的因素有很多,包括色彩搭配、版式布局、交互体验等方面,以下是一些基本原则和建议:
- 简洁明了:保持页面的整洁有序,避免过多的元素干扰用户的视线。
- 一致性:使用统一的视觉风格和设计元素来增强品牌的识别度。
- 响应式设计:随着移动设备的普及,越来越多的用户会通过手机和平板电脑访问网站,采用响应式设计可以让网站在不同设备上都能呈现出良好的效果。
- 用户体验:注重用户体验的设计理念,让用户能够轻松找到所需的信息并进行操作。
编写HTML/CSS/JavaScript代码
HTML(超文本标记语言)用于定义网页的结构;CSS(层叠样式表)则用来控制外观和行为;而JavaScript则是实现动态效果的脚本语言,三者相互配合可以实现丰富多彩的网络应用。
HTML部分
- :使用语义化的标签来组织内容,便于搜索引擎抓取和分析。
- 可访问性:遵循WAI-ARIA规范,使残障人士也能正常浏览和使用网站。
CSS部分
- 模块化编写:将样式分成多个文件,方便管理和维护。
- 媒体查询:根据屏幕尺寸调整样式,实现自适应布局。
JavaScript部分
- 前端框架:利用React、Vue.js等现代前端框架简化开发过程。
- AJAX技术:异步加载数据,提高页面加载速度和用户体验。
测试与部署
完成编码后,需要在本地环境中对网站进行全面测试,以确保其功能和性能都达到预期标准,常见的方法包括单元测试、集成测试以及负载压力测试等,只有经过充分测试并通过了所有指标的网站才适合正式上线。
单元测试
针对单个组件或模块进行独立测试,验证其是否符合预期的行为和结果。
图片来源于网络,如有侵权联系删除
集成测试
将各个独立的模块组合在一起进行整体测试,确保它们之间能够正确协同工作。
负载压力测试
模拟大量并发访问的场景下观察系统的表现情况,以此来评估其在高流量环境下的稳定性。
当一切就绪之后,就可以将网站部署到云端服务器上了,这一步通常涉及以下几个步骤:
- FTP上传:使用FTP客户端工具将制作好的网站文件传输至
本文链接:https://www.zhitaoyun.cn/1786110.html
发表评论